Finding the Turkish Embassy in Indonesia: Location and Contact Details
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ty. Where exactly is the Turkish Embassy in Indonesia located? And how can you get in touch with them? Here's all the info you need. The embassy is located in a strategic location that is accessible and safe. The precise address, as of the current date, is: Jalan HR Rasuna Said Kav. 1, Jakarta Selatan, DKI Jakarta. This location is in the heart of Jakarta. It's easily accessible by various modes of transport, including public transportation and private vehicles. Now, if you need to contact them, here are the details: you can reach them by phone at +62 21 520 3200 or you can send a fax to +62 21 520 3206. For general inquiries, you can send an email to embassy.jakarta@mfa.gov.tr. They also have an official website where you can find more information about their services, visa requirements, and upcoming events. The address for the website is jakarta.emb.mfa.gov.tr/Mission. Visa Information and Requirements for Indonesian Citizens
So, you're an Indonesian citizen dreaming of exploring the beautiful landscapes and rich culture of Turkey? Awesome! But before you pack your bags, you'll need to sort out your visa. The Turkish Embassy in Indonesia is the place to go for all your visa needs. Visa requirements can vary depending on the purpose of your visit, so it's super important to understand the specific requirements for your situation. For tourism, you'll typically need a valid passport, a visa application form, passport-sized photos, a return ticket, and proof of sufficient funds to cover your stay. For those planning to study in Turkey, you'll need an acceptance letter from a Turkish university, along with other academic documents. If you're going to work in Turkey, you'll need a work permit and a visa. Make sure to check the official website of the Turkish Embassy in Indonesia for the most up-to-date requirements. Services Offered by the Turkish Embassy in Indonesia
Besides visa services, the Turkish Embassy in Indonesia provides a wide range of services to Turkish citizens and, in some cases, to Indonesian citizens as well. These services cover various aspects of consular affairs and are designed to assist citizens in different situations. For Turkish citizens, the embassy offers passport services, including issuing new passports, renewing existing ones, and replacing lost or stolen passports. They also provide assistance with civil registration matters. They can assist with registering births, deaths, and marriages. If you're facing legal issues in Indonesia, the embassy can provide consular assistance, such as contacting your family, providing a list of local lawyers, and ensuring that you are treated fairly under Indonesian law. In emergencies, the embassy is there to provide support and guidance. They can help with repatriation in cases of serious illness, injury, or death. They also provide notary services, such as certifying documents and verifying signatures. Moreover, they often organize cultural events and promote educational exchange programs. Consular Services Explained
Consular services are a critical part of the embassy's role. They involve providing assistance and support to Turkish citizens in Indonesia. For example, if you lose your passport, the embassy can issue you a temporary travel document, so you can return to Turkey. If you're arrested or detained, the embassy can provide consular assistance, such as contacting your family, visiting you in jail, and ensuring you have access to legal representation. In the event of an emergency, such as a natural disaster or a medical emergency, the embassy can provide assistance and guidance. This can include helping you contact your family, providing information about local resources, and coordinating with local authorities.
